摘要

Disclosed are methods, systems, device, and other implementations, including a method that includes receiving an audio signal representation, detecting in the received audio signal representation, using a first learning model, one or more silent intervals with reduced foreground sound levels, determining based on the detected one or more silent intervals an estimated full noise profile corresponding to the audio signal representation, and generating with a second learning model, based on the received audio signal representation and on the determined estimated full noise profile, a resultant audio signal representation with a reduced noise level.
机译:公开了方法、系统、设备和其他实现,包括一种方法,该方法包括接收音频信号表示,使用第一学习模型在所接收的音频信号表示中检测一个或多个具有降低前景声级的静音间隔,基于检测到的一个或多个静默间隔确定与音频信号表示相对应的估计全噪声剖面,并基于接收到的音频信号表示和确定的估计全噪声剖面,使用第二学习模型生成具有降低噪声电平的结果音频信号表示。
